Q: Is 12,732,558 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 12,732,558 is not a prime number.

Why is 12,732,558 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 12732558 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 17 34 43 51 86 102 129 258 731 1,462 2,193 2,903 4,386 5,806 8,709 17,418 49,351 98,702 124,829 148,053 249,658 296,106 374,487 748,974 2,122,093 4,244,186 6,366,279 and 12,732,558, with no remainder.

Since 12,732,558 cannot be divided by just 1 and 12,732,558, it is not a prime number.
